2.1.3.2 Switching between online and offline
The printer does not have an online/offline switch.
The printer goes offline:
1) Between when the power is turned on (including reset using the interface) and when the printer is
ready to receive data.
2) During the self-test.
3) When the cover is open.
4) During paper feeding using the paper feed button.
5) When the printer stops printing due to paper-end (in cases when an empty paper supply is
detected by either paper roll and detector or the paper roll near-end detector with a printing halt
feature set enabled due to paper shortage by ESC c 4).
6) During macro executing standby status.
7) When a temporary abnormality occurs in the power supply voltage.
8) When an error has occurred.
9) When the receive buffer becomes f ull. (*1)
*1 Definition of “receive buffer full”
When the receive buffer capacity is specified to 4 KB (DIP SW1-2 is Off):
If the DIP SW2- 5 is off, when the rem aining space in the rec eive buffer drops to 128 bytes,
the printer status becomes “buffer full” and it remains “buffer full” until the space in the
receive buffer increases to 256 bytes.
If the DIP SW2- 5 is on, when the remaining spac e in the receive buff er drops to 128 bytes,
the printer status becomes “buffer full” and it remains “buffer full” until the space in the
receive buffer increases to 138 bytes.
When the receive buffer capacity is specified to 45 bytes (DIP SW1-2 is On):
Regardless of the DIP SW 2-5 setting, when the remaining space in the receive buffer drops
to 16 bytes, the printer status becomes “buffer full” and it remains “buffer full” until the space
in the receive buffer increases to 26 bytes.
The printer ignores the data received when the rema ining space in the receive buffer
is 0 bytes.
